MRI Technologist
$39.16 - $60.42 per hourIntermountain Health
Job Description:
As an MRI Technologist, you will be responsible for performing diagnostic MRI exams on patients using specialized equipment. You will work closely with radiologists, physicians, and other healthcare professionals to ensure accurate and high-quality imaging results.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of imaging techniques, excellent patient care skills,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ment.Posting Details
- Shift Details / Times: 30 hrs / week. Shifts will vary according to department need. Options include Mon - Fri 6:30a - 5p, 8:30a - 7p, Sat-Sunday 7a-6p
- Unit/Location: Park City Hospital
- Additional Details: Sign-on Bonus up to $5000 for eligible candidates
Essential Functions
- Maintains American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) or modality-specific competency in all clinical and technical functions.
- Ensures proper patient identification, order verification, and prepares the patient for the exam.
- Performs exams per department protocol and reviews images for quality, clarity, and accuracy.
- Adheres to MRI safety guidelines and maintains a safe working environment.
- Completes studies within acceptable time limits without compromising patient care or quality.
- Assists and instructs students and other MRI Techs in exam protocols, procedures, positioning, and equipment.
- Provides appropriate patient education, ensures patient comfort, and addresses concerns.
- Practices appropriate infection control and sterile techniques.
- Understands and operates equipment and related information systems to ensure quality images.
- Keeps accurate records of patient information, procedures performed, and any adverse reactions.
- Follows protocols for medical necessity, coding, charging, consents, QC programs, and reporting equipment failures.

Minimum Qualifications
- American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T)(MR) or American Registry of Magnetic Resonance Imaging Technologists (ARMRIT) or American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T)(R) cross-trained in MRI
- Basic Life Support certification (BLS) for healthcare providers
- IV Competency within 30 days of hire
Preferred Qualifications
- 1-2 years of MRI technologist experience
- Bachelor‘s degree from an accredited institution
